Microsoft to expand its Dublin data centre with $130m investment to further increase capacity and growing demand for cloud services across Europe

Transforming businessThu, 23 Feb 2012 10:30:00 GMT

Microsoft today announced that it is investing an additional US$130 million to expand its data centre located in Dublin, Ireland. The expansion is driven by increased demand for Microsoft’s cloud services. This investment builds on the original $500m investment Microsoft made in the Dublin data centre, which has been operational since July 2009, serving customers across Europe, the Middle East and Africa (EMEA). Microsoft’s Local Language Program Bridges Languages, Cultures and Technology

Fueling growth and healthy communitiesTue, 21 Feb 2012 11:00:00 GMT

In recognition of International Mother Language Day, Microsoft, a strong supporter of language preservation, today highlighted the company’s Local Language Program (LLP). LLP enables 1.7 billion people worldwide to access technology in their own language, while striving to preserve those local languages and cultural identities. Some of the services and programs available through LLP include localised versions of Windows and Microsoft Office, available in 37 languages, and Language Interface Packs, supported by through free downloads for Windows, Office and Visual Studio, available in nearly 100 languages. Microsoft Supports Safer Internet Day and Reveals Results From Microsoft Computing Safety Index

Fueling growth and healthy communitiesMon, 06 Feb 2012 09:00:00 GMT

For the fourth year running, Microsoft is supporting Safer Internet Day (7 Feb 2012), an event organised by Insafe, a European Commission initiative to raise internet safety awareness. Microsoft also releases the latest findings from the Microsoft Computing Safety Index, revealing that a majority of consumers have basic online security protection, but are less knowledgeable about how to defend against cybercrime threats such as phishing, identity theft and fraudulent links.

Online Reputation Management Is a Two-Way Street

Fueling growth and healthy communitiesTue, 24 Jan 2012 12:00:00 GMT

Microsoft is marking Data Privacy Day 2012 by releasing new data that reveals how one's online activities- if not well managed - can have serious consequences for their online reputation. The survey of 5,000 people in the US, Germany, Canada, Ireland and Spain finds that 14 per cent of people believe they have been negatively impacted by the online activities of others. Anywhere Working Consortium launches online portal

Transforming businessMon, 16 Jan 2012 12:00:00 GMT

The Anywhere Working Consortium today unveiled an online portal that will help UK organisations adopt more flexible working practices. The portal will serve as a resource for employers and employees alike, offering training, guidance, case studies and product offers from the consortium, whose members include Business in the Community, Microsoft, Nokia, Nuffield, Regus and Vodafone UK. Microsoft & Monte Vibiano, Virtualisation and its role in a 360° Green IT vision Virtual Press Room

Fri, 31 Jul 2009 10:00:00 GMT

Deep in the Italian countryside, a wine and olive oil producer is taking an innovative approach to becoming a leaner and greener business. Monte Vibiano – an award winning winery based in Umbria, Italy – has a serious vision, to become the world's first carbon neutral farm. Central to this vision is the company's 360° green initiative, which is transforming how the business operates from the vine to the data centre. IT has played a key role in the modernization of the business, Monte Vibiano is virtualising its servers and introducing other innovative technologies to achieve its vision.
